The Illustrator

Miki Tanaka

Miki Tanaka is credited on Pokémon Trading Card Game cards from 1999 to 2025, with more than 190 illustrations across series including Neo, E-Card, and Scarlet & Violet. The work is largely cartoonish and playful, with clear compositions and vibrant, pastel-leaning color.

Curatorial Commentary

“The card depicts Paras nestled among lush green foliage, its bright red body adorned with yellow spots. The scene captures a quiet moment in the forest, where the Pokémon seems to blend into its surroundings, embodying the tranquility of nature. With its curious expression, Paras appears to be at ease, perhaps contemplating its next move or simply enjoying the serene ambiance. This snapshot conveys a sense of harmony between the creature and its environment.”
